The Story of Thine
as told through the ages of time
Tell me your stories, your magic is mine.
In the land of consequences and time
Where reality breeds stories that grew as vines
*****
All that you see might very well look fine
Yet behind it disguises the masks of crimes
Looks can be deceiving as lies combine
*****
As you explore and see the details redefined
Of the adventures of characters long lost in rhymes
Told and changed over some period decline
*****
Tales of the old with lost meaning resign
Brought to new life with each generation’s chime
In new light bring meanings redesigned
*****
Only investigation can reveal the truth align
To see where the stories might just climb
To last for longer than the writers inclined
Alas to your stories might just last through time enshrined
